#627d28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#627d28 is composed of 38.4% red, 49%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 68%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 79.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 32.4%. #627d28 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4fa50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#627d28 color description : Dark moderate green.
#627d28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#627d28 has RGB values of R:98, G:125,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 6454568.

Shades and Tints of #627d28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fafc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#627d28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54574e is the less saturated color, while #70a302 is the most saturated one.
